Output 985daf4a31151c7681e30714c093759411251ba695d2b058d2fdbd8378a6fb44:1

value
17268832
script pubkey
OP_0 OP_PUSHBYTES_20 96c77f18860709933a58fd6dabcec9648a5aeee4
address
ltc1qjmrh7xyxquyexwjcl4k6hnkfvj994mhyc5qvqx
transaction
985daf4a31151c7681e30714c093759411251ba695d2b058d2fdbd8378a6fb44
spent
true